How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Douglas?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Douglas Studio Apartments | $1,970 | $1,027 | $5,948 |
Douglas 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,069 | $1,065 | $5,380 |
Douglas 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,510 | $1,250 | $7,358 |
Douglas 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,111 | $1,485 | $10,000+ |
Douglas 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,129 | $981 | $2,229 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Douglas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Douglas with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Douglas is at Lake Meadows Apartments listed at $1,425.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Douglas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Douglas is $2,510.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Douglas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Douglas is a 1,292 square feet unit starting from $3,130 at Arrive LEX.
What is the average size for Douglas 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Douglas is currently 1,214 sq ft.
